Union Cabinet Approves Rs 2,585 Crore Small Hydro Power Development Scheme

The Union Cabinet approved the Small Hydro Power Development Scheme with a Rs 2,585 crore outlay for FY 2026-27 to FY 2030-31, targeting 1,500 MW capacity from projects sized 1-25 MW. Emphasizing run-of-river technology, the scheme focuses on environmentally friendly power generation, especially in hilly and North Eastern states. It offers financial assistance up to Rs 3.6 crore per MW in these regions and Rs 2.4 crore per MW elsewhere, aiming to attract Rs 15,000 crore investment and generate employment while supporting indigenous manufacturing and future project planning.
